In DJI GO under Main Controller Settings > Advanced Settings > is Enter Flight Data Mode
Pressing it says - "Connect aircraft with computer by USB port, and then export available flight data. Restart aircradft to exit flight data mode."

How does doing this differ from simply connecting a USB betwen aircraft and computer (with it powered on) and dragging the files across with explorer or finder?


By this I mean is there any need to actually go into this Enter Flight Data Mode menu instead of just connecting the two devices and moving files across to Computer.


Also because using Windows 10 whenever I connect the mavic it reports disk error with the SD card (D Drive). I tried reformatting it with Mavic and no change. Tried formatting it with Windows 10 and this fixed the error until the Mavic rebooted and rebuilt its file system on the card. Then the error message returned. Is this anything to be concirned about or just Wndows 10 being a PITA.

"Flight Data Mode" is to get the flight logs form the aircraft. You need to use thre DJI Assistant 2 software also. It has nothing to do with getting photos/video off your SD card. The Mavic has its own storage for the log files.
